Abstract: The invention relates to an arrangement for adjusting the length of a carrying section of a child carrier, intended for carrying a child on an adult's front, back, or hip, the carrier comprising further upper support elements attached to the carrying section and to be placed over the wearer's shoulders, and lower support elements to be placed around the wearer's body, wherein the carrier is equipped with adjustment elements, with which a multi-stepped or stepless length adjustment of the carrying section is arranged to be carried out.
Abstract: This invention relates to an arrangement for adjusting the width of a carrier (1), which carrier (1) includes at least a carrying section (2) intended for carrying a child, upper support elements (65) attached to the carrying section and placed over the wearer's shoulders, and lower support elements (66) to be placed around the wearer's body. The carrying section (2) is equipped with widening sections (3, 4), which are attached at least to the lower support elements (66).
Abstract: This invention relates to an arrangement for adjusting the height of a carrier (1), which carrier (1) includes at least a carrying section (2) intended for carrying a child, upper support elements (5, 6) attached to the carrying section and placed over the wearer's shoulders, and lower support elements (7-9) to be placed around the wearer's body. The carrying section (2) is equipped at least with essentially webbing like adjustment elements (10, 11, 14), with which the multistepped or stepless height adjustment is designed to be carried out.
